The Starr Scholarship
The Starr Scholarship is only available to young American artists for an artist-in-residence at the Royal Academy Schools with tenure of one year. The Helen Lempriere Travelling Art Scholarship 2008
The Helen Lempriere Travelling Art Scholarship, now valued at $60,000, is intended to enable an artist, at the outset of their career, to undertake further art studies overseas at a recognised art institution, or to undertake a study program with a senior artist, for one to two years. AWARD OF SCHOLARSHIP TO LEARN HINDI IN CENTRAL INSTITUTE, AGRA, INDIA
Central Institute of Hindi, Agra is an autonomous organisation of Government of India which runs courses at various levels for foreigners to teach Hindi.
